AI Leadership Exodus Rattles Investor Confidence Amid Capex Boom
High-profile departures at top AI labs — Brad Lightcap's exit from OpenAI and an unnamed researcher's departure from Alphabet/Google that triggered a share-price drop — are surfacing talent retention as a market risk factor even as hyperscalers pour record capital into AI infrastructure. The reaction shows investors treating key-person risk at frontier AI labs as material to valuation, a new fragility layered onto an otherwise bullish AI-driven capex cycle.

Platinum Future Bearish By 2% In The Last 24 Hours

Platinum Future Bearish By 2% In The Last 24 Hours

Platinum is currently on bearish momentum. At 15:07 EST on Friday, 9 April, Platinum is at $1,206.20 and 2.36% down since the last session's close.

Platinum Range

Concerning Platinum's daily highs and lows, it's 1.959% down from its trailing 24 hours low of $1,230.30 and 2.474% down from its trailing 24 hours high of $1,236.80.

Volatility

Platinum's last week, last month's, and last quarter's current volatility was a positive 0.43%, a negative 0.03%, and a positive 1.89%, respectively.

Platinum's current volatility rank, which measures how volatile a financial asset is (variation between the lowest and highest value in a period), was 1.01% (last week), 1.51% (last month), and 1.89% (last quarter), respectively.

Commodity Price Classification

According to the stochastic oscillator, a useful indicator of overbought and oversold conditions, Platinum's commodity is considered to be oversold (<=20).
